Problem mit fetch_assoc.....

mrepox

Erfahrenes Mitglied
Code:
$options =    array();
$connection = Connect_to_db("Vars.inc");

$results = mysql_query("SELECT dept_id, name

                                      FROM Department

                                      ORDER BY name",$connection);

while($row = mysql_fetch_assoc($results)) {
  $options['dept_id'][$row['dept_id']] = $row['name'];
}

Habe diese Zeilen von mysqli auf mysql umgeschrieben, bekomme in der Zeile mit fetch_assoc immer folgende Fehlermeldung:

Code:
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in

Wer weiß was da nicht msyql valide ist?
 
Zuletzt bearbeitet:
Häng mal an die $results = …-Zeile noch ein or die(mysql_error()); an – dann sollte dir der Server eigentlich sagen, was mit der Anfrage nicht in Ordnung ist. (Syntaktische Fehler seh ich jedenfalls keine – evtl. wird »Department« klein geschrieben?)
 
kannst du das mal in der zeile zusammenfügen, ich glaube ich bin heute zu blöd!!

habe immer unexepted ";" inder zeile
Code:
$results = mysqli_query($connection, "SELECT dept_id, name
                                      FROM Department
                                      ORDER BY name" 
                                      or die(mysql_error());
 
Zuletzt bearbeitet:
Probiers mal hiermit:
PHP:
$results = mysql_query("SELECT dept_id, name
                                      FROM Department
                                      ORDER BY name", $connection) or die(mysql_error());
 
Es bleibt immer noch bei der Fehlermeldungm, keine andere Aussage:

Code:
Warning: mysql_fetch_assoc(): supplied argument is not a valid MySQL result resource in /is/htdocs/wp1017003_DYRZ8LZK1W/www/fields_login.inc on line 66

Hier nochmal der Auszug des Scriptes:

Code:
$options =    array();



$connection = Connect_to_db("Vars.inc");

$results = mysql_query("SELECT dept_id, name
                                      FROM Department
                                      ORDER BY name", $connection) or die(mysql_error()); 

while($row = mysql_fetch_assoc($options['dept_id'][$row['dept_id']] = $row['name'])) {
  $results;
}
 
Hab das genau das Selbe Problem!

Und bei MySQL Error kommt das:
Code:
You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'gbook.php, 6' at line 1


Und hier mein PHP Code:
PHP:
<?php 
require ("gbconfig.php"); 
$conn_id = mysql_connect($host,$id,$pw); 
mysql_select_db($database,$conn_id); 
$Zeilen_pro_Seite = 6; 
$result = mysql_query("SELECT * from $table ORDER BY datum DESC LIMIT $site, $Zeilen_pro_Seite") or die(mysql_error()); 
$result1=mysql_query("select id from $table"); 

$Anzahl = mysql_num_rows($result1); 
while($row = mysql_fetch_assoc($result)); 
{ 
?>


btw... Ich bin bei http://www.funpic.de... hat das vielleicht damit zutun?
 
Zurück